During the Areopagus for Renewable Energy 2021 conference, organized by Stowarzyszenie na Rzecz Efektywności im. prof. Krzysztof Żmijewski, president of Polskie Sieci Elektroenergetyczne (PSE), Eryk Kłossowski, assessed that one should stop believing that “connected power systems have the nature of a copper plate and will send electricity from anywhere to anywhere in all circumstances”. According to him, it will not be possible to remove all restrictions on the energy market or to create perfect competition.

As emphasized by the president of PSE, there are network limitations that will never be removed. This is due to unprofitability, and in addition, trade does not take place in perfect competition. According to Kłossowski, “each market participant has a different expected rate of return, a different type of access to information and a different strategy. Actually, all the assumptions of neoclassical economics will crumble when confronted with the market reality. They are total fiction and pyramidal nonsense”.

According to the president of PSE, Europa needs a multi-commodity market and awareness of network constraints, and a market in which prices are a signal for localization should also be created.
